Where to Buy Bearings

Finding reliable suppliers for bearings can be a daunting task. Here are some key avenues to explore:

  • Online Marketplaces: Amazon, eBay, and other online marketplaces offer a wide range of bearings, often at competitive prices.
  • Industrial Distributors: Companies like Grainger and McMaster-Carr specialize in industrial supplies, including bearings of various types and sizes.
  • Manufacturers: Many bearing manufacturers sell their products directly to customers, providing technical support and customization options.
  • Local Hardware Stores: Some hardware stores carry a limited selection of bearings for common applications, such as automotive repair.

Why Bearings Matter

Bearings play a vital role in a multitude of industries, including:

  • Automotive: Transmissions, steering systems, and wheels require high-precision bearings for smooth operation and durability.
  • ** Aerospace:** Bearings used in aircraft must withstand extreme temperatures, vibration, and loads for safety and reliability.
  • Industrial Equipment: Electric motors, pumps, and conveyors rely on bearings to minimize friction and extend lifespan.
  • Consumer Products: Appliances, power tools, and bicycles incorporate bearings to improve performance and comfort.

How to Buy Bearings

When purchasing bearings, consider the following factors:

  • Application: Determine the specific function and operating conditions of the bearing.
  • Type: Choose from ball bearings, roller bearings, or other specialized types based on load capacity, speed, and precision requirements.
  • Material: Select bearing materials suitable for the intended environment and load conditions, such as steel, stainless steel, or ceramic.
  • Size: Specify the inner and outer dimensions, as well as the width and tolerance of the bearing.
  • Quantity: Determine the number of bearings required based on application needs.

Bearing Material Advantages Disadvantages
Steel Durable, Cost-effective Can corrode
Stainless Steel Corrosion-resistant More expensive
Ceramic High-speed, Low-friction Brittle

Effective Strategies for Buying Bearings

  • Research bearing manufacturers and distributors to find reputable suppliers.
  • Consult technical experts to determine the optimal bearing type and material for your application.
  • Request samples or specifications to verify bearing dimensions and quality.
  • Consider bulk purchasing to reduce unit costs and streamline inventory management.
  • Implement a preventive maintenance program to monitor bearing health and extend lifespan.

How to Buy Bearings Step-by-Step

  1. Identify the application and operating conditions.
  2. Determine the required bearing type, size, and material.
  3. Research and select reputable suppliers.
  4. Request quotes and compare pricing and delivery options.
  5. Place an order and specify quantity, delivery address, and any special requirements.
  6. Inspect bearings upon delivery to ensure accuracy and quality.
  7. Implement a maintenance plan to prolong bearing lifespan.
